about

all songs written by Wing Dam (Sara Autrey, Austin Tally, Abram Sanders)
recorded and produced by Chester Endersby Gwazda at the Annex, Baltimore MD, October 2014
mastered by Heba Kadry at Timeless Mastering
front cover: "Dream Catcher" by D'Metrius John Rice

released on limited edition 7" vinyl by Slow Knife Records
(Brooklyn, NY)
Slow Knife 003

"Heavy guitar pop that sits somewhere between the heavenly fuzz of Hum and the nostalgic sun-glazed bliss of Siamese Dream."
(Dischord Records)

"The sludge that unearth’s itself from Wing Dam‘s “House Boat” is decorated with little silvery, electronic shocks of guitar licks and flushed drums. Like a silky flag, their tender vocal harmony rises from the heavy noise and pinching bass. “Are we killing time as we’re punching the clock?” the song wonders. “House Boat” serves as a beautiful and introspective introduction to a band that has so much left to say."
(Portals)

"Baltimore’s Wing Dam give nods to grunge, retro-‘90s fuzz and emo without engulfing themselves too much in any one sound...Guitars steer off into the distance while slugging away for life, while vocals range from tense and anxious to all-out, guttural chants."
(DIY Magazine)

"Wing Dam sit somewhere between 90’s grunge and recent sound-scaping indie and Never Never Land. So slippy and free of labels is their sound that they are managing to move through the gears without one ounce of the heavy burden of a ‘genre’ straddled to their back."
(Far Out Magazine, UK)
